From 4bbabc092a7b675eb5b624c3d647e216e98dbe2d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Dmitrii Kovalkov <34828390+DimasKovas@users.noreply.github.com> Date: Wed, 9 Jul 2025 21:16:06 +0400 Subject: [PATCH] tests: wait for flush lsn in test_branch_creation_before_gc (#12527) ## Problem Test `test_branch_creation_before_gc` is flaky in the internal repo. Pageserver sometimes lags behind write LSN. When we call GC it might not reach the LSN we try to create the branch at yet. ## Summary of changes - Wait till flush lsn on pageserver reaches the latest LSN before calling GC. --- test_runner/regress/test_branch_and_gc.py | 4 ++++ 1 file changed, 4 insertions(+) diff --git a/test_runner/regress/test_branch_and_gc.py b/test_runner/regress/test_branch_and_gc.py index 8447c9bf2d..148f469a95 100644 --- a/test_runner/regress/test_branch_and_gc.py +++ b/test_runner/regress/test_branch_and_gc.py @@ -7,6 +7,7 @@ from typing import TYPE_CHECKING import pytest from fixtures.common_types import Lsn, TimelineId from fixtures.log_helper import log +from fixtures.neon_fixtures import wait_for_last_flush_lsn from fixtures.pageserver.http import TimelineCreate406 from fixtures.utils import query_scalar, skip_in_debug_build @@ -162,6 +163,9 @@ def test_branch_creation_before_gc(neon_simple_env: NeonEnv): ) lsn = Lsn(res[2][0][0]) + # Wait for all WAL to reach the pageserver, so GC cutoff LSN is greater than `lsn`. + wait_for_last_flush_lsn(env, endpoint0, tenant, b0) + # Use `failpoint=sleep` and `threading` to make the GC iteration triggers *before* the # branch creation task but the individual timeline GC iteration happens *after* # the branch creation task.
